Adaptive voice-feature-enhanced matchmaking method and system

A computer-based matchmaking method utilizing numerical representations of voice as well facial features to improve matchmaking capabilities, the voice features preferably including articulation quality measures, speed of speech measures, audio energy measures, fundamental frequency measures, and relative audio periods. Certain preferred embodiments include: plastic-surgery-unique anthropometric facial measures to enhance system effectiveness; use of both standard and non-standard facial points idenified by Gabor kernel-based filtering; and adapting to user preferences by adjusting system parameters based on user responses to potential matches.

Matrix quantization and mixed excitation based linear predictive speech coding at very low bit rates
Özaydın, Selma; Baykal, Buyurman (Elsevier BV, 2003-10)
A matrix quantization scheme and a very low bit rate vocoder is developed to obtain good quality speech for low capacity communication links. The new matrix quantization method operates at bit rates between 400 and 800 bps and using a 25 ms linear predictive coding (LPC) analysis frame, spectral distortion about 1 dB is achieved at 800 bps.
